Systems Engineer Senior - F-35 DPHM Business Operations
Lockheed Martin is a global aerospace and defense company, and they are seeking a Systems Engineer Senior for the F-35 DPHM Business Operations team. This role involves managing integrated work plans, guiding executing teams, and overseeing the technical, schedule, and cost performance of the F-35 DPHM capabilities.
